Output 40391d302b26800a88872d0a1ae65ffaf136f98acfd856d9358c88820d2c928f:1

value
624426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1036b435e8e639370a49dd4a448e4c6208d1423 OP_EQUALVERIFY OP_CHECKSIG
address
1H8xhWanBxxK7R6sGkrWH6DNwPAwxb7nHt
transaction
40391d302b26800a88872d0a1ae65ffaf136f98acfd856d9358c88820d2c928f
spent
true